Classes

Classes are probably the most effective and preferred way to conduct safety training.

There is no specified length for a "safety class," so a five-minute session covering a specific safety concern should be documented as well as longer, more formal sessions.

EHS offers a wide variety of safety classes, but safety-related classes conducted by other instructors/sources are certainly acceptable to meet quarterly requirements.  Many Wellness Center classes, for example, might qualify.  Annual Hazard Communications training may be used to meet one quarter's requirements.

Class rosters are one of the most efficient ways to document safety training classes.
